Rich Dad Poor Dad for Teens by Robert T Kiyosaki

This special just-for-teens edition based on the Rich Dad Poor Dad series, builds a foundation of self-confidence from which readers can realise their dreams of financial security in an increasingly challenging and unreliable job market. Teen-friendly advice, examples, sidebars, and straight talk will supplement all of Rich Dad's core advice: Work to learn, not to earn. Don't say, 'I can't afford it?' And, don't work for money - make money work for you! No matter how confident or 'good in school' readers consider themselves to be, this book makes financial intelligence available to all young people with its streamlined structure, clean design, and accessible voice. Here's a book that teaches teens what they don't learn in school - and what many of their parents have yet to learn.
Robert T. Kiyosaki is a tireless promoter who continues to get words of financial advice out to mainstream consumers through his bestselling books, board game, electronic game and national seminars. Sharon L. Lechter is a consultant to the toy and publishing industries, and a business owner
